Output 3835aab3d489f6157d24c035ce2561a98df7e59cf3f50bbc4c25a3534a647535:53

value
62728
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e5bf1bcd6f645a9285ee43aa6af9f6d79987596 OP_EQUAL
address
35v99mZNSgrHkwwBK5vp18z8886ECDtH7C
transaction
3835aab3d489f6157d24c035ce2561a98df7e59cf3f50bbc4c25a3534a647535
spent
true